The Position

Sequencing.com is seeking a Variant Curator to support the accuracy and reliability of genetic variant interpretation. This role will involve reviewing reports, analyzing genomic data, and improving variant classification methodologies to enhance customer insights.

Responsibilities

  • Review variant reports for inconsistencies in variant calling and data interpretation.
  • Investigate and classify variants associated with conditions that have not yet been submitted to ClinVar.
  • Enhance the value of ClinVar data by associating unclassified variants with known conditions.
  • Analyze raw genetic data files to support customer inquiries and troubleshooting.
  • Contribute to the development and refinement of AI prompts for improved genetic accuracy in AI-driven variant interpretation.

Qualifications

  • 2+ years experience with variant classification and genomic databases (ClinVar, gnomAD, HGMD).
  • Familiarity with NGS data analysis and raw genetic data interpretation.
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Experience in clinical variant interpretation or curation.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and ability to work independently.
  • Knowledge of Python or R for data analysis.
  • Experience with bug tracking and Agile tools such as JIRA and Confluence.
